A Little History About Bryant’s

Jimmy and Jane Bryant opened a Loeb’s Bar-B-Q franchise in the Parkway Village area of Memphis in 1968. In 1977, they moved the restaurant to its current location on Summer Avenue. For many years, bar-b-q was the main restaurant business. Jimmy was responsible for initiating the breakfast menu, specializing in homemade biscuits. Jimmy and Jane can both trace their roots to Calhoun County, Mississippi. It was there that Jimmy’s mother would cook the most wonderful homemade biscuits and southern breakfast. He wanted to share that food with others. While it is an extremely labor intensive effort, we continue to this day to make by hand every biscuit we serve here at Bryant’s.

Continuing the tradition that their parents began, Kerrie and Phil can be found at the restaurant working the counter and taking your order.

We have 10 employees at Bryant’s. Most of our employees have been with us for over ten years, with some over twenty years.

We are primarily known in Memphis for our breakfast. Homemade biscuits. Country Ham. Omelets. Gravy, Grits. We have been serving plate lunches that have become very popular the past 3 or 4 years.
